Stories are according to values handed down by more mature generations to condition the foundation of the Local community.[47] Storytelling is made use of to be a bridge for expertise and knowing letting the values of "self" and "Neighborhood" to attach and be realized in general. Storytelling within the Navajo Group one example is allows for Group values to be acquired at different times and places for various learners. Stories are informed within the standpoint of other people, animals, or perhaps the all-natural features of your earth.

Mother and father in the Arizona Tewa Local community, such as, teach morals to their little ones by means of regular narratives.[fifty] Lessons deal with several subject areas including historic or "sacred" stories or even more domestic disputes. By way of storytelling, the Tewa Local community emphasizes the traditional knowledge in the ancestors and the necessity of collective and also unique identities.
